Hi Akram,
I believe all the roles in any company should receive training in project management.
As PMP, you have to take care of core aspects of the deliverables and tasks, such as Scope, Time, Cost and Quality.
In fact, HR is one of the knowledge areas of the Project Management Body of Knowledge (PMBOK).
So, adding this mix of knowledge together, you - as an HR manager - will hopefully select candidates not only by reading their resume, but by digging deeper into the background of the person taking into consideration what really matters in any job: how the person has taken care of the tasks assigned to him/her, the time invested, and the quality of the deliverable.
